Edward C. Colcord

December 1, 1920 — November 8, 2003

Edward C. Colcord 82, 601 S. 21st Avenue, Wausau died Saturday, November 8, 2003 at his home under the care of Comfort Care and Hospice Services. Ed was born December 1, 1920 in Monroe Center, son of the late Harry and Martha (Morley) Colcord. On August 29, 1942 he married Lorraine Mohr in Wuertzburg. She survives. Prior to his retirement, Ed worked for Wausau Metals as a production cordinator. He enjoyed hunting, fishing, spending time at the cottage, wood working and traveling. Ed was a veteran of the U.S. Army serving in World War II and was a member of Veterans of Foreign Wars Burns Post #388, Wausau. Survivors besides his wife Lorraine include three daughters, Audrey Bishop, Schofield, Donna Borth, Wausau and Mary (Paul) Lenzner, Merrill, six grandchildren and three great grandchildren. Besides his parents Ed was preceded in death by one daughter, Janet Rich and two brothers.
